About Fumaric Acid 99.5% For Synthesis



Fumaric Acid 99.5% For Synthesis is a high-quality organic acid classified as Industrial Grade with a purity level of 99.5%. It is a crystalline powder with an odorless smell and slightly acidic taste, commonly used as a pH regulator and intermediate in chemical synthesis processes. This fine chemical, with the molecular formula C4H4O4, plays a vital role in the production of synthetic resins. With its non-poisonous properties and solubility in alcohol and ether, Fumaric Acid 99.5% is an essential component in various industries like food additives, pharmaceuticals, and chemical synthesis.
